Many errors found!,
By "chs473" (Missouri) - See all my reviews
This review is from: Kitchen Spanish - a Quick Phrase Guide of Kitchen and Culinary Terms (Paperback)
I am a Spanish teacher and I was thinking of buying this book. After looking at one sample page, I would NOT buy this book! The single page I looked at is full of errors. The commands are incorrect. They also switch between formal and informal commands. Here are examples of errors and the correct forms in the informal:close the door--cerrada la puerta--should be cierra la puerta. cook this--coce este--should be cuece este do this--hagas esto--should be haz esto do you need help?--tú necesitas ayude?--should be Necesitas tú ayuda? There are many more, and this is just one page of it. I would NOT recommend this book!
